Judge Drops 146 Charges in Food Bank Scam

SANTA ANA - Orange County Judge Steven Perk Wednesday dropped all 40 charges against Glendora attorney James Brian Watkins, accused along with his father and law partner, John Franklyn Watkins, LaVerne residents Steven and Denise Oleesky and several private investigators of obstruction of justice and scamming millions from a food bank for blind athletes.
